Fozgometer Owner Alert !
If you own and use a Fozgometer to set azimuth you must calibrate the unit or your results will not be accurate. I had stopped using my Fozgometer and instead was setting azimuth using a digital oscilloscope, which is 100% accurate and also gives you precise crosstalk voltages.

"Garage Sale" Find Has QRP Adding 13 Additional Record Presses! (Now Video Enhanced)
Quality Record Pressing announced today that thirteen additional presses will soon go online at its Salina, Kansas facility after discovering them recently lying dormant in a Chicago warehouse.
